      I did new front shocks from universal parts with welding some parts from old shocks to make these fit. Now I can adjust maximum drop by adjusting the shocks position up and down, so I can limit the drop to right position with airbags..if i bag this. Those springs were taken of because my rims are too wide to use without hitting.
